COOKING: MEASURING

m. Summary: Explains why cooks must be careful in measuring, illustrates some of the measuring devices used in the kitchen, and demonstrates the correct procedures for measuring dry solids, liquids, and fats. For high school and college classes. Credits: Author: Arthur H. Wolf; adviser, Edna A. Hill

A renewal would have appeared in the Copyright Office's renewal registrations 27 to 29 years after the term began. Those volumes are loaded and no matching renewal was found. A work published 1931–1963 that was not renewed entered the public domain at the end of its 28th year.

A renewal had to be filed in the 28th year and would be listed in the 1976 or 1977 volume; volumes searched: 1976, 1977, 1978.
